Ukrainian Banks Form Consortium for UAH 21.5 Billion Defense Loan Agreement

DEFENSE

Ukrainian banks have established a record consortium loan agreement totaling UAH 21.5 billion to support a defense-industrial complex enterprise. The loan, secured by a state guarantee, will be financed by six state-owned and private banks over a three-year term.

The National Bank of Ukraine (NBU) emphasized the importance of this agreement for risk-sharing and stable financing in defense sector projects. Previously, the banking sector collaborated to support energy restoration projects, securing UAH 33.5 billion for initiatives, including a total capacity of 1.3 GW for generation restoration. The NBU has highlighted defense financing as a national priority, encouraging banks to engage more actively in lending for defense-industry enterprises.
